Company Profile

China Mobile Limited (the “Company”, and together with its
subsidiaries, the “Group”) was incorporated in Hong Kong on 3
September 1997. The Company was listed on the New York Stock
Exchange (“NYSE”) and The Stock Exchange of Hong Kong Limited
(“HKEx” or the “Stock Exchange”) on 22 October 1997 and 23
October 1997, respectively. The Company was admitted as a
constituent stock of the Hang Seng Index in Hong Kong on 27 January
1998. As the leading mobile services provider in Mainland China, the
Group boasts the world’s largest mobile network and the world’s
largest mobile customer base. In 2012, the Company was once again
selected as one of the “FT Global 500” by Financial Times and “The
World’s 2,000 Biggest Public Companies” by Forbes magazine, and
was again recognized on the Dow Jones Sustainability Indexes (“DJSI”).
The Company currently has a corporate credit rating of Aa3/Outlook
Positive from Moody’s Investor Service and AA-/Outlook Stable from
Standard & Poor’s, equivalent to China’s sovereign credit rating
respectively.
